Writer's Workshop: Adding More Sounds
Not long ago, we learned a new strategy when labeling our pictures which is counting how many sounds we hear and draw lines for each sound. This way helps them know how many letters they will need to write. Today, I am going to continue teaching them how to count the sounds they hear by labeling parts of a pre-drawn train.
